"textContent": "A redox flow battery, comprising a first electrolyte storage (), a second electrolyte storage (), an electrochemical cell connected to said first and second electrolyte storages (), wherein said electrochemical cell comprises a first half-cell and a second half-cell, wherein said first half-cell comprises a cathode (), wherein said second half-cell comprises an anode (), wherein said first and second half-cells are separated from each other by an ion exchange membrane (), wherein said first electrolyte storage comprises an aqueous solution comprising an iron complex of a compound of formula I and stereoisomers of compound of formula I.",
